Role Overview

As an Asset Care Technician at PepsiCo's Leicester site, you'll play a crucial role in keeping our state-of-the-art manufacturing equipment running smoothly. This position suits skilled electricians and mechanics passionate about maintenance and reliability. Working 42 hours across 3.5 days per week (Tues-Thurs 12-hour shifts 06:30-18:30, plus Fri 06:30-12:30), you'll align with site engineering shutdowns to ensure production lines for Walkers crisps operate at peak performance. Deliver technical support to Engineering and Operations, handling planned and reactive maintenance while driving continuous improvements.

Key Responsibilities

In this dynamic role, you'll collaborate across teams to maintain and optimize our production assets. Key duties include:

  • Partnering with Maintenance Planners, Line Engineering Leads, and Manufacturing Technicians to complete all planned maintenance tasks efficiently.
  • Offering reactive support to Shift Technicians and Operations during high-demand periods.
  • Linking with Controls System Specialists, Electrical Duty Holders, and Reliability experts for preventative work orders and in-depth analysis.
  • Supporting specialist teams in action completion and continuous improvement initiatives, including health, safety, and food safety measures.
  • Ensuring maintenance plans, task instructions, and stores holdings are accurate and up-to-date.
  • Leading root cause analysis and creating visual management tools for planned maintenance.
  • Acting as an ambassador for engineering standards and best practices site-wide.

Qualifications & Requirements

To succeed, you'll need proven technical expertise and a proactive mindset:

  • NVQ Level 3 or equivalent engineering apprenticeship with substantial hands-on experience.
  • Recognized electrical or mechanical academic qualification.
  • Strong mechanical knowledge and familiarity with CMMS (Computerized Maintenance Management Systems) and SCADA systems.
  • Solid understanding of equipment and technical standards.
  • Excellent problem-solving skills, a sense of ownership for safety, quality, and performance, and strong communication abilities.
